Output 73e38fae631b56a2898dd6f436cf63529655c591998743fdfdc59049d59ca59b:0

value
668341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60d2c879b2102715ad138441e5f86f92a8b5b98e OP_EQUAL
address
3AWyJRgz5VJk1qB7eYv5g2QLnp3J3XeA6n
transaction
73e38fae631b56a2898dd6f436cf63529655c591998743fdfdc59049d59ca59b
spent
true